package

androidx.wear.protolayout.expression.proto

Interfaces

AnimationParameterProto.AnimationParametersOrBuilder
AnimationParameterProto.AnimationSpecOrBuilder
AnimationParameterProto.CubicBezierEasingOrBuilder
AnimationParameterProto.EasingOrBuilder
AnimationParameterProto.RepeatableOrBuilder
DynamicDataProto.DynamicDataValueOrBuilder
DynamicProto.AnimatableDynamicColorOrBuilder
DynamicProto.AnimatableDynamicFloatOrBuilder
DynamicProto.AnimatableDynamicInt32OrBuilder
DynamicProto.AnimatableFixedColorOrBuilder
DynamicProto.AnimatableFixedFloatOrBuilder
DynamicProto.AnimatableFixedInt32OrBuilder
DynamicProto.ArithmeticFloatOpOrBuilder
DynamicProto.ArithmeticInt32OpOrBuilder
DynamicProto.BetweenDurationOrBuilder
DynamicProto.ComparisonFloatOpOrBuilder
DynamicProto.ComparisonInt32OpOrBuilder
DynamicProto.ConcatStringOpOrBuilder
DynamicProto.ConditionalColorOpOrBuilder
DynamicProto.ConditionalDurationOpOrBuilder
DynamicProto.ConditionalFloatOpOrBuilder
DynamicProto.ConditionalInstantOpOrBuilder
DynamicProto.ConditionalInt32OpOrBuilder
DynamicProto.ConditionalStringOpOrBuilder
DynamicProto.DynamicBoolOrBuilder
DynamicProto.DynamicColorOrBuilder
DynamicProto.DynamicDurationOrBuilder
DynamicProto.DynamicFloatOrBuilder
DynamicProto.DynamicInstantOrBuilder
DynamicProto.DynamicInt32OrBuilder
DynamicProto.DynamicStringOrBuilder
DynamicProto.DynamicZonedDateTimeOrBuilder
DynamicProto.FloatFormatOpOrBuilder
DynamicProto.FloatToInt32OpOrBuilder
DynamicProto.GetDurationPartOpOrBuilder
DynamicProto.GetZonedDateTimePartOpOrBuilder
DynamicProto.InstantToZonedDateTimeOpOrBuilder
DynamicProto.Int32FormatOpOrBuilder
DynamicProto.Int32ToFloatOpOrBuilder
DynamicProto.LogicalBoolOpOrBuilder
DynamicProto.NotBoolOpOrBuilder
DynamicProto.PlatformInt32SourceOrBuilder
DynamicProto.PlatformTimeSourceOrBuilder
DynamicProto.StateBoolSourceOrBuilder
DynamicProto.StateColorSourceOrBuilder
DynamicProto.StateDurationSourceOrBuilder
DynamicProto.StateFloatSourceOrBuilder
DynamicProto.StateInstantSourceOrBuilder
DynamicProto.StateInt32SourceOrBuilder
DynamicProto.StateStringSourceOrBuilder
FixedProto.FixedBoolOrBuilder
FixedProto.FixedColorOrBuilder
FixedProto.FixedDurationOrBuilder
FixedProto.FixedFloatOrBuilder
FixedProto.FixedInstantOrBuilder
FixedProto.FixedInt32OrBuilder
FixedProto.FixedStringOrBuilder
VersionProto.VersionInfoOrBuilder

Classes

AnimationParameterProto
AnimationParameterProto.AnimationParameters
 Animation specs of duration, easing and repeat delay.
AnimationParameterProto.AnimationParameters.Builder
 Animation specs of duration, easing and repeat delay.
AnimationParameterProto.AnimationSpec
 Animation parameters that can be added to any animatable node.
AnimationParameterProto.AnimationSpec.Builder
 Animation parameters that can be added to any animatable node.
AnimationParameterProto.CubicBezierEasing
 The cubic polynomial easing that implements third-order Bezier curves.
AnimationParameterProto.CubicBezierEasing.Builder
 The cubic polynomial easing that implements third-order Bezier curves.
AnimationParameterProto.Easing
 The easing to be used for adjusting an animation's fraction.
AnimationParameterProto.Easing.Builder
 The easing to be used for adjusting an animation's fraction.
AnimationParameterProto.Repeatable
 The repeatable mode to be used for specifying how many times animation will
 be repeated.
AnimationParameterProto.Repeatable.Builder
 The repeatable mode to be used for specifying how many times animation will
 be repeated.
DynamicDataProto
DynamicDataProto.DynamicDataValue
 A dynamic data value.
DynamicDataProto.DynamicDataValue.Builder
 A dynamic data value.
DynamicProto
DynamicProto.AnimatableDynamicColor
 A dynamic interpolation node.
DynamicProto.AnimatableDynamicColor.Builder
 A dynamic interpolation node.
DynamicProto.AnimatableDynamicFloat
 A dynamic interpolation node.
DynamicProto.AnimatableDynamicFloat.Builder
 A dynamic interpolation node.
DynamicProto.AnimatableDynamicInt32
 A dynamic interpolation node.
DynamicProto.AnimatableDynamicInt32.Builder
 A dynamic interpolation node.
DynamicProto.AnimatableFixedColor
 A static interpolation, between two fixed color values.
DynamicProto.AnimatableFixedColor.Builder
 A static interpolation, between two fixed color values.
DynamicProto.AnimatableFixedFloat
 A static interpolation, between two fixed floating point values.
DynamicProto.AnimatableFixedFloat.Builder
 A static interpolation, between two fixed floating point values.
DynamicProto.AnimatableFixedInt32
 A static interpolation, between two fixed int32 values.
DynamicProto.AnimatableFixedInt32.Builder
 A static interpolation, between two fixed int32 values.
DynamicProto.ArithmeticFloatOp
 An arithmetic operation, operating on two Float instances.
DynamicProto.ArithmeticFloatOp.Builder
 An arithmetic operation, operating on two Float instances.
DynamicProto.ArithmeticInt32Op
 An arithmetic operation, operating on two Int32 instances.
DynamicProto.ArithmeticInt32Op.Builder
 An arithmetic operation, operating on two Int32 instances.
DynamicProto.BetweenDuration
 A dynamic duration type that represents the duration between two dynamic time
 instants.
DynamicProto.BetweenDuration.Builder
 A dynamic duration type that represents the duration between two dynamic time
 instants.
DynamicProto.ComparisonFloatOp
 A comparison operation, operating on two Float instances.
DynamicProto.ComparisonFloatOp.Builder
 A comparison operation, operating on two Float instances.
DynamicProto.ComparisonInt32Op
 A comparison operation, operating on two Int32 instances.
DynamicProto.ComparisonInt32Op.Builder
 A comparison operation, operating on two Int32 instances.
DynamicProto.ConcatStringOp
 This implements simple string concatenation "result = LHS+RHS"
DynamicProto.ConcatStringOp.Builder
 This implements simple string concatenation "result = LHS+RHS"
DynamicProto.ConditionalColorOp
 A conditional operator which yields a color depending on the boolean
 operand.
DynamicProto.ConditionalColorOp.Builder
 A conditional operator which yields a color depending on the boolean
 operand.
DynamicProto.ConditionalDurationOp
 A conditional operator which yields a duration depending on the boolean
 operand.
DynamicProto.ConditionalDurationOp.Builder
 A conditional operator which yields a duration depending on the boolean
 operand.
DynamicProto.ConditionalFloatOp
 A conditional operator which yields a float depending on the boolean
 operand.
DynamicProto.ConditionalFloatOp.Builder
 A conditional operator which yields a float depending on the boolean
 operand.
DynamicProto.ConditionalInstantOp
 A conditional operator which yields a instant depending on the boolean
 operand.
DynamicProto.ConditionalInstantOp.Builder
 A conditional operator which yields a instant depending on the boolean
 operand.
DynamicProto.ConditionalInt32Op
 A conditional operator which yields an integer depending on the boolean
 operand.
DynamicProto.ConditionalInt32Op.Builder
 A conditional operator which yields an integer depending on the boolean
 operand.
DynamicProto.ConditionalStringOp
 A conditional operator which yields an string depending on the boolean
 operand.
DynamicProto.ConditionalStringOp.Builder
 A conditional operator which yields an string depending on the boolean
 operand.
DynamicProto.DynamicBool
 A dynamic boolean type.
DynamicProto.DynamicBool.Builder
 A dynamic boolean type.
DynamicProto.DynamicColor
 A dynamic color type.
DynamicProto.DynamicColor.Builder
 A dynamic color type.
DynamicProto.DynamicDuration
 A dynamic duration type.
DynamicProto.DynamicDuration.Builder
 A dynamic duration type.
DynamicProto.DynamicFloat
 A dynamic float type.
DynamicProto.DynamicFloat.Builder
 A dynamic float type.
DynamicProto.DynamicInstant
 A dynamic time instant type.
DynamicProto.DynamicInstant.Builder
 A dynamic time instant type.
DynamicProto.DynamicInt32
 A dynamic int32 type.
DynamicProto.DynamicInt32.Builder
 A dynamic int32 type.
DynamicProto.DynamicString
 A dynamic string type.
DynamicProto.DynamicString.Builder
 A dynamic string type.
DynamicProto.DynamicZonedDateTime
 A dynamic zoned date-time type.
DynamicProto.DynamicZonedDateTime.Builder
 A dynamic zoned date-time type.
DynamicProto.FloatFormatOp
 Simple formatting for dynamic floats.
DynamicProto.FloatFormatOp.Builder
 Simple formatting for dynamic floats.
DynamicProto.FloatToInt32Op
 Converts a Float to an Int32, with a customizable rounding mode.
DynamicProto.FloatToInt32Op.Builder
 Converts a Float to an Int32, with a customizable rounding mode.
DynamicProto.GetDurationPartOp
 Retrieve the specified duration part of a DynamicDuration instance as a
 DynamicInt32.
DynamicProto.GetDurationPartOp.Builder
 Retrieve the specified duration part of a DynamicDuration instance as a
 DynamicInt32.
DynamicProto.GetZonedDateTimePartOp
 Retrieve the specified date-time part of a DynamicZonedDateTime instance as a
 DynamicInt32.
DynamicProto.GetZonedDateTimePartOp.Builder
 Retrieve the specified date-time part of a DynamicZonedDateTime instance as a
 DynamicInt32.
DynamicProto.InstantToZonedDateTimeOp
 Converts a DynamicInstant into a DynamicZonedDateTime.
DynamicProto.InstantToZonedDateTimeOp.Builder
 Converts a DynamicInstant into a DynamicZonedDateTime.
DynamicProto.Int32FormatOp
 Simple formatting for dynamic int32.
DynamicProto.Int32FormatOp.Builder
 Simple formatting for dynamic int32.
DynamicProto.Int32ToFloatOp
 An operation to convert a Int32 value in the dynamic data pipeline to a Float
 value.
DynamicProto.Int32ToFloatOp.Builder
 An operation to convert a Int32 value in the dynamic data pipeline to a Float
 value.
DynamicProto.LogicalBoolOp
 A logical boolean operator, implementing "boolean result = LHS <op> RHS",
 for various boolean operators (i.e.
DynamicProto.LogicalBoolOp.Builder
 A logical boolean operator, implementing "boolean result = LHS <op> RHS",
 for various boolean operators (i.e.
DynamicProto.NotBoolOp
 A boolean operation which implements a "NOT" operator, i.e.
DynamicProto.NotBoolOp.Builder
 A boolean operation which implements a "NOT" operator, i.e.
DynamicProto.PlatformInt32Source
 A dynamic Int32 which sources its data from some platform data source, e.g.
DynamicProto.PlatformInt32Source.Builder
 A dynamic Int32 which sources its data from some platform data source, e.g.
DynamicProto.PlatformTimeSource
 A dynamic time instant that sources its value from the platform.
DynamicProto.PlatformTimeSource.Builder
 A dynamic time instant that sources its value from the platform.
DynamicProto.StateBoolSource
 A dynamic boolean type which sources its data from the tile's state.
DynamicProto.StateBoolSource.Builder
 A dynamic boolean type which sources its data from the tile's state.
DynamicProto.StateColorSource
 A dynamic Color which sources its data from the tile's state.
DynamicProto.StateColorSource.Builder
 A dynamic Color which sources its data from the tile's state.
DynamicProto.StateDurationSource
 A dynamic Duration which sources its data from the a state entry.
DynamicProto.StateDurationSource.Builder
 A dynamic Duration which sources its data from the a state entry.
DynamicProto.StateFloatSource
 A dynamic Float which sources its data from the tile's state.
DynamicProto.StateFloatSource.Builder
 A dynamic Float which sources its data from the tile's state.
DynamicProto.StateInstantSource
 A dynamic Instant which sources its data from the a state entry.
DynamicProto.StateInstantSource.Builder
 A dynamic Instant which sources its data from the a state entry.
DynamicProto.StateInt32Source
 A dynamic Int32 which sources its data from the tile's state.
DynamicProto.StateInt32Source.Builder
 A dynamic Int32 which sources its data from the tile's state.
DynamicProto.StateStringSource
 A dynamic String which sources its data from the tile's state.
DynamicProto.StateStringSource.Builder
 A dynamic String which sources its data from the tile's state.
FixedProto
FixedProto.FixedBool
 A fixed boolean type.
FixedProto.FixedBool.Builder
 A fixed boolean type.
FixedProto.FixedColor
 A fixed color type.
FixedProto.FixedColor.Builder
 A fixed color type.
FixedProto.FixedDuration
 A fixed duration type.
FixedProto.FixedDuration.Builder
 A fixed duration type.
FixedProto.FixedFloat
 A fixed float type.
FixedProto.FixedFloat.Builder
 A fixed float type.
FixedProto.FixedInstant
 A fixed time instant type.
FixedProto.FixedInstant.Builder
 A fixed time instant type.
FixedProto.FixedInt32
 A fixed int32 type.
FixedProto.FixedInt32.Builder
 A fixed int32 type.
FixedProto.FixedString
 A fixed string type.
FixedProto.FixedString.Builder
 A fixed string type.
VersionProto
VersionProto.VersionInfo
 Version information.
VersionProto.VersionInfo.Builder
 Version information.

Enums

AnimationParameterProto.AnimationParameters.OptionalDelayMillisCase
AnimationParameterProto.Easing.InnerCase
AnimationParameterProto.RepeatMode
 The repeat mode to specify how animation will behave when repeated.
DynamicDataProto.DynamicDataValue.InnerCase
DynamicProto.ArithmeticOpType
 The type of arithmetic operation used in ArithmeticInt32Op and
 ArithmeticFloatOp.
DynamicProto.ComparisonOpType
 The type of comparison used in ComparisonInt32Op and ComparisonFloatOp.
DynamicProto.DurationPartType
 The duration part to retrieve using GetDurationPartOp.
DynamicProto.DynamicBool.InnerCase
DynamicProto.DynamicColor.InnerCase
DynamicProto.DynamicDuration.InnerCase
DynamicProto.DynamicFloat.InnerCase
DynamicProto.DynamicInstant.InnerCase
DynamicProto.DynamicInt32.InnerCase
DynamicProto.DynamicString.InnerCase
DynamicProto.DynamicZonedDateTime.InnerCase
DynamicProto.FloatFormatOp.OptionalMaxFractionDigitsCase
DynamicProto.FloatFormatOp.OptionalMinIntegerDigitsCase
DynamicProto.FloatToInt32RoundMode
 Rounding mode to use when converting a float to an int32.
DynamicProto.Int32FormatOp.OptionalMinIntegerDigitsCase
DynamicProto.LogicalOpType
 The type of logical operation to carry out in a LogicalBoolOp operation.
DynamicProto.PlatformInt32SourceType
 The type of data to provide to a PlatformInt32Source.
DynamicProto.ZonedDateTimePartType
 The date-time part to retrieve using ZonedDateTimePartOp.